The guys I play with have a variety of acoustic guitars. NONE of their acoustics are nylon strings. The reason for this is most nylon string guitars are made like classical guitars . . .
I just did a bit of research and discovered that there are such things as ball-end nylon strings that can be fitted to a regular, non-classical acoustic guitar. Apparently they are favored by folk guitarists who want a mellower sound.
Perhaps they could be the solution.
